[PATCH v1 3/4 RFC] rtc: pcf2127: implement reading battery status bits

From: Uwe Kleine-KÃnig
Date: Fri Oct 02 2015 - 05:17:55 EST


The rtc features a battery switch-over function. Export battery status
and if a switch-over occured via sysfs.

Signed-off-by: Uwe Kleine-KÃnig <u.kleine-koenig@xxxxxxxxxxxxxx>
---

Notes:
Note this patch is wrong, don't merge!

Calling sysfs_create_files in the driver's probe is too late. I didn't
find a nice alternative though. But in case someone feels like pointing
me in the right direction or using this even with this being wrong, here
comes the patch anyhow.

drivers/rtc/rtc-pcf2127.c | 132 +++++++++++++++++++++++++++++++++++++++++++++-
1 file changed, 130 insertions(+), 2 deletions(-)

diff --git a/drivers/rtc/rtc-pcf2127.c b/drivers/rtc/rtc-pcf2127.c
index 7eb6ff26185e..db057db88031 100644
--- a/drivers/rtc/rtc-pcf2127.c
+++ b/drivers/rtc/rtc-pcf2127.c
@@ -22,7 +22,11 @@

#define PCF2127_REG_CTRL1 (0x00) /* Control Register 1 */
#define PCF2127_REG_CTRL2 (0x01) /* Control Register 2 */
+
#define PCF2127_REG_CTRL3 (0x02) /* Control Register 3 */
+#define PCF2127_REG_CTRL3_BF 0x08
+#define PCF2127_REG_CTRL3_BLF 0x04
+
#define PCF2127_REG_SC (0x03) /* datetime */
#define PCF2127_REG_MN (0x04)
#define PCF2127_REG_HR (0x05)
@@ -54,7 +58,7 @@ static int pcf2127_get_datetime(struct i2c_client *client, struct rtc_time *tm)
return -EIO;
}

- if (buf[PCF2127_REG_CTRL3] & 0x04)
+ if (buf[PCF2127_REG_CTRL3] & PCF2127_REG_CTRL3_BLF)
dev_info(&client->dev,
"low voltage detected, check/replace RTC battery.\n");

@@ -186,10 +190,116 @@ static const struct rtc_class_ops pcf2127_rtc_ops = {
.set_time = pcf2127_rtc_set_time,
};

+struct pcf2127_bitattr {
+ struct device_attribute attr;
+ unsigned bitmask;
+};
+
+static ssize_t pcf2127_bitattr_clear(struct device *dev,
+ struct device_attribute *attr,
+ const char *buf, size_t count)
+{
+ struct i2c_client *client = to_i2c_client(dev);
+ unsigned char i2cbuf[2] = { PCF2127_REG_CTRL3, };
+ struct pcf2127_bitattr *bitattr =
+ container_of(attr, struct pcf2127_bitattr, attr);
+ int ret;
+ long val;
+
+ if (!count)
+ return 0;
+
+ ret = kstrtol(buf, 0, &val);
+ if (ret)
+ return ret;
+
+ /* we only accept writing 0 */
+ if (val != 0)
+ return -EINVAL;
+
+ ret = i2c_master_send(client, i2cbuf, 1);
+ if (!ret)
+ ret = -EIO;
+ if (ret < 0)
+ return ret;
+
+ ret = i2c_master_recv(client, i2cbuf + 1, 1);
+ if (!ret)
+ ret = -EIO;
+ if (ret < 0)
+ return ret;
+
+ i2cbuf[1] &= ~bitattr->bitmask;
+
+ ret = i2c_master_send(client, i2cbuf, 2);
+ if (!ret)
+ ret = -EIO;
+ if (ret < 0)
+ return ret;
+
+ return count;
+}
+
+static ssize_t pcf2127_bitattr_show(struct device *dev,
+ struct device_attribute *attr,
+ char *buf)
+{
+ struct i2c_client *client = to_i2c_client(dev);
+ unsigned char reg = PCF2127_REG_CTRL3;
+ struct pcf2127_bitattr *bitattr =
+ container_of(attr, struct pcf2127_bitattr, attr);
+ int ret;
+
+ ret = i2c_master_send(client, &reg, 1);
+ if (!ret)
+ ret = -EIO;
+ if (ret < 0)
+ return ret;
+
+ ret = i2c_master_recv(client, &reg, 1);
+ if (!ret)
+ ret = -EIO;
+ if (ret < 0)
+ return ret;
+
+ return scnprintf(buf, PAGE_SIZE,
+ "%d\n", !!(reg & bitattr->bitmask));
+}
+
+static struct pcf2127_bitattr pcf2127_battery_low = {
+ .attr = {
+ .attr = {
+ .name = "battery_low",
+ .mode = S_IRUGO,
+ },
+ .show = pcf2127_bitattr_show,
+ },
+ .bitmask = PCF2127_REG_CTRL3_BLF,
+};
+
+static struct pcf2127_bitattr pcf2127_battery_switch_over = {
+ .attr = {
+ .attr = {
+ .name = "battery_switch_over",
+ .mode = S_IWUSR | S_IRUGO,
+ },
+ .show = pcf2127_bitattr_show,
+ .store = pcf2127_bitattr_clear,
+ },
+ .bitmask = PCF2127_REG_CTRL3_BF,
+};
+
+static const struct attribute *pcf2127_attributes[] = {
+ &pcf2127_battery_low.attr.attr,
+ &pcf2127_battery_switch_over.attr.attr,
+ NULL
+};
+
static int pcf2127_probe(struct i2c_client *client,
const struct i2c_device_id *id)
{
struct pcf2127 *pcf2127;
+ int ret;

dev_dbg(&client->dev, "%s\n", __func__);

@@ -203,11 +313,28 @@ static int pcf2127_probe(struct i2c_client *client,

i2c_set_clientdata(client, pcf2127);

+ ret = sysfs_create_files(&client->dev.kobj, pcf2127_attributes);
+ if (ret < 0) {
+ dev_err(&client->dev, "failed to register sysfs attributes\n");
+ return ret;
+ }
+
pcf2127->rtc = devm_rtc_device_register(&client->dev,
pcf2127_driver.driver.name,
&pcf2127_rtc_ops, THIS_MODULE);

- return PTR_ERR_OR_ZERO(pcf2127->rtc);
+ if (IS_ERR(pcf2127->rtc)) {
+ ret = PTR_ERR(pcf2127->rtc);
+ sysfs_remove_files(&client->dev.kobj, pcf2127_attributes);
+ }
+
+ return ret;
+}
+
+static int pcf2127_remove(struct i2c_client *client)
+{
+ sysfs_remove_files(&client->dev.kobj, pcf2127_attributes);
+ return 0;
}

static const struct i2c_device_id pcf2127_id[] = {
@@ -231,6 +358,7 @@ static struct i2c_driver pcf2127_driver = {
.of_match_table = of_match_ptr(pcf2127_of_match),
},
.probe = pcf2127_probe,
+ .remove = pcf2127_remove,
.id_table = pcf2127_id,
};
